安卓开发中值得注意的事项
布局优化
在开发安卓应用时,布局优化是至关重要的,因为好的布局可以提升用户的使用体验。要注意不同屏幕和分辨率的适配问题,可以使用ConstraintLayout等新的布局方式来解决。此外,还需要避免过多的嵌套布局和过度绘制,可以通过使用RecyclerView等控件来优化布局。
内存和性能优化
在开发过程中,内存和性能优化也是必不可少的。其中,内存泄漏是常见的问题,可以使用LeakCanary等工具来进行检测和解决。在代码编写阶段,需要注意减少对内存的占用,尽量避免过多无用的对象的创建和未释放。同时,可以使用工具来检测性能瓶颈,尽量避免卡顿现象和界面刷新延迟,提升用户的使用体验。
安全性能优化
在应用开发中,安全性能优化更是必不可少的。在开发时需要注意保护用户的隐私信息,如禁止使用非必要的权限,合理申请权限信息等。还需要防范网络安全威胁,如防范信息泄露,数据篡改等等。为了保证应用的安全性,可以加密存储数据,防范病毒攻击等。
,在开发安卓应用时,布局优化,内存和性能优化以及安全性能优化都是不可忽视的,需要运用各种工具和技术来进行解决和优化。只有将这些问题解决好,才能让应用具备更好的质量和用户体验。